A late-night checklist I use before spending XP — FC 26 Tiny Tim Evolution requirements
When I open an objective, I first scan the hard gates. You should too.
- Overall: Max 91
- PlayStyle: Max 10
- PlayStyle+: Max 3
- Not Rarity: World Tour Silver Stars
- Position: ST

What are the Tiny Tim Evolution requirements?
Each level requires one match played with the active EVO player in any mode. That’s deliberately cheap: the investment is time, not coins.
Which stats does Tiny Tim boost?
There are five upgrade levels. Read them like a shopping list and pick cards that already have the traits you want to amplify.
Level 1 upgrades
- Overall: +25 | 93
- Aggression: +40 | 97
- Finishing: +35 | 95
- Reactions: +35 | 95
- Volleys: +35 | 96
- PlayStyles+: Low Driven Shot | 3
Level 2 upgrades
- Acceleration: +15 | 91
- Agility: +25 | 90
- Heading Acc.: +40
- Long Shots: +30 | 93
- Weak Foot: +4
- PlayStyles+: Enforcer | 3
Level 3 upgrades
- Balance: +25 | 90
- Jumping: +40 | 97
- Positioning: +30 | 93
- Vision: +30 | 91
- Positions: LM, RM
Level 4 upgrades
- Ball control: +25 | 92
- Short Passing: +30 | 93
- Sprint Speed: +15 | 93
- Strength: +30 | 94
- PlayStyles: Finesse Shot, Incisive Pass | 8
Level 5 upgrades
- Dribbling: +25 | 92
- Shot Power: +35 | 96
- Stamina: +30 | 92
- Composure: +35 | 95
- PlayStyles: First Touch, Precision Header | 8
Level upgrade requirements
- Play 1 match in any mode using your active EVO player in game — for Levels 1 through 5.
I keep a shortlist of candidates in my transfers tab — Best players to use in Tiny Tim Evolution
Some cards eat these upgrades and come out as match-clinching strikers; others get bloated but ineffective. You want the former.
- Marcus Rashford — Winter Wildcards: Speed plus finishing scales well with the Finese Shot and Shot Power gains.
- Ousmane Dembélé — Ultimate Scream: Dribbling and agility gains marry to his existing flair; use with FUTBIN to check final numbers.
- Antoine Griezmann — Knockout Royalty: Vision and positioning boosts turn him into a secondary creator from ST.
- Endrick — FC Fantasy: Young card that benefits from raw stat inflation and added playstyles.
- Vinícius Jr. — TOTW: His dribble and sprint ceiling paired with Tiny Tim’s playstyles make him a nightmare on counters.
- Ermedin Demirović — Showdown: Heading and strength increases give him an aerial edge.
- Thierry Henry — Winter Wildcards: Combine with other evolutions if you want a historic icon that ages like a fine weapon.
- Rafael Leão — Ultimate Scream: Best when stacked with other evolutions for pace and finishing amplification.
- Neymar Jr.: Use only if you’re pairing evolutions—Tiny Tim turns finesse into scoring consistency.
- Gabriel Silva — World Tour: Cheap pick that becomes much harder to contain after the upgrades.
- Iñaki Williams — FUT Birthday: Stamina and strength lifts make him relentless over 90 minutes.
My rule of thumb? Favor cards that already carry three meta PlayStyle+ tags. Tiny Tim doesn’t add many PlayStyle+ slots, but it massively inflates core attacking numbers. You can use FUTWIZ or FUTBIN to model the final ratings before you commit.
